Little did I anticipate my path. It began with symphonic music and two degrees in oboe. (Listen for the classical instruments in my music.) I played professionally with the El Paso Symphony and the Las Cruces Symphony, when God rapidly opened (alongside some painfully shut) doors to songwriting. Now, I have fun digitally distorting the oboe/English Horn to imitate horns and even - heaven forbid - saxophones.
Matthew Odmark, of the Jars of Clay, has been my producer for my last two projects, which has been a fantastic collaboration at Gray Matters Studio in Nashville TN. For Over Under, Sara Groves consulted and Peter Katis (The National, Jonsi) mixed tracks. What a dream.
People compare my sound to Regina Spektor, Ingrid Michaelson, Ellie Holcomb, and Joanna Newsom.
Oh...and I play piano.
I started playing piano in first grade. It was an epic start. : ) Winning your first competition by playing a total of twelve notes is intense.
When I am not preventing my three young girls from destroying everything, I lead music for Resurrection San Diego.
